MavMail is the official University email service powered by Microsoft Outlook. It is the official communication method for Minnesota State University, Mankato.


D2L Brightspace is the learning management system software at Minnesota State University, Mankato.


MavPrint is a student printing service available to all currently-enrolled students. MavPrint provides students use of over 40 printers at various locations throughout the Mankato and Edina campuses as well as residence halls including Stadium Heights Residence Community.

Qualtrics is a web-based survey software for creative, collaborative, and highly customizable user response collection.


Shorten URLs and create QR codes with link.mnsu.edu, while tracking clicks and scans—all at no cost for students, faculty, and staff.


LinkedIn Learning is a customizable and personalized learning platform with thousands of expert video tutorials on a wide array of topics like business, technology, design, and more.


Zoom is a web-based video conferencing app that allows users to meet online with up to 300 participants in a meeting or 500 in a webinar from any device including Windows and Mac computers, and Android and iOS devices.


IT Solutions provides technology help and support at Minnesota State University, Mankato, including Wi-Fi, StarID, MavMail, software download, and more.


Supports essential university operations and decision-making. Data reports can draw from various sources, including Minnesota State's ISRS, internally maintained databases, or other specified data sources. Reports can be customized to meet the specific needs of departments, covering a wide range of data types and formats.


MavLabs allows you to log in to select on-campus computer labs from your own computer, wherever you are, to access specialty academic software for Windows like SPSS, R-Studio, ArcGIS, CAD programs, programming editors, database servers, Microsoft Access, geography labs, physics, biology and more.


Turnitin is an anti-plagiarism tool that allows educators to check students' work for improper citation or potential plagiarism by comparing it against continuously updated databases.

The Campus Computer Store is the official technology store at Minnesota State University, Mankato for both personal and department purchasing, offering a wide array of computers, peripherals, accessories, and other technology equipment.


The Microsoft Authenticator App helps you sign in to your accounts with using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A).


Microsoft 365 is the official suite of apps at Minnesota State University, Mankato. Students and employees can download Word, Excel, Outlook, OneDrive, and more.


YuJa Panorama helps faculty, staff, and students create, improve, and access digital content in formats that meet accessibility needs.


The Information Security team identifies, assesses, and mitigates risks related to information security as well as educates campus about cybersecurity best practices and awareness.


Technology Asset Management oversees the full life cycle of University‑owned technology assets such as computers, tablets, and phones. This service ensures secure handling of technology assets, accurate inventory records, and compliance with Minnesota State requirements from purchase through retirement.


Video Conferencing facilitates real-time communication through video and audio connections using tools like Zoom, Microsoft Teams, and FlexSync.


IT Solutions provides services such as media captioning, braille production, document conversion, accessibility consulting, and more to support Universal Design for Learning, digital accessibility, and help ensure compliance with legal standards.


Zoom Phone is the University's phone system for employees with unlimited domestic calls, text messaging, voicemail transcription, call recording, and seamless app integrations. Access Zoom Phone on your laptop or smart device in the Zoom app, or choose to have a traditional desk phone in addition.


WorkMSU allows employees to virtually access a comprehensive collection of campus software and services remotely.


Workday is a cloud-based system where employees can complete tasks like entering time, creating reports, managing purchases, and many other HR and finance tasks. Additionally, all university faculty and staff job positions are posted and applied for using Workday.


Consulting, creation, maintenance, and troubleshooting for the official Minnesota State University, Mankato website. This service assists colleges, divisions, departments, and programs with developing, editing, and maintaining web content to meet university brand standards and accessibility requirements.
